Dr. Mark Moitoza, D.Min., serves as Vice Chancellor for Evangelization with the Archdiocese for the Military Services, USA, which is based in Washington, D.C. Mark also serves on the executive board of the National Catholic Young Adult Ministry Association. He grew up in a military-connected family while his dad served as a career officer in the U.S. Air Force. Mark holds a Bachelor of Arts in Economics from the University of Rhode Island in Kingston, Rhode Island; a Bachelor of Arts and Master of Arts in Religious Studies from the Katholieke Universiteit Leuven in Belgium; and a Doctor of Ministry from the Graduate Theological Foundation in South Bend, Indiana. Mark was the National Federation for Catholic Youth Ministry's military youth ministry coordinator at two U.S. Army posts in Germany, Heidelberg and Mannheim, from 1999 to 2003. He is the author of Unpacking Faith: A Resource for Catholic Military Connected Adolescents and their Parents. Mark and his wife Sherry live in Germantown, Maryland, and have three children.
